tools/go/gcimporter
Alan Donovan 1f29e74bfa go.tools/go/types: remove Type.MethodSet() method.
Method-set caching is now performed externally using a MethodSetCache (if desired), not by the Types themselves.

This a minor deoptimization due to the extra maps, but avoids a situation in which method-sets are computed and frozen prematurely. (See b/7114)

LGTM=gri
R=gri
CC=golang-codereviews
https://golang.org/cl/61430045
2014-02-11 16:49:27 -05:00
..
testdata go.tools/go/types: move gcimporter to its own package 2013-11-14 14:11:43 -08:00
exportdata.go go.tools/go/gcimporter: adjust for new .a file format 2013-12-18 10:53:59 -08:00
gcimporter.go go.tools/go/gcimporter: correct package for imported methods 2014-01-07 14:46:10 -08:00
gcimporter_test.go go.tools/go/types: remove Type.MethodSet() method. 2014-02-11 16:49:27 -05:00